How to prepare for bliss burn:
a list of essentials for our unique gathering in the jungle
Gathering
Checklist:
important basics
Downloaded QR code ticket
Photo ID
Mobile phone and charger, if possible, a solar power bank
Bring enough water and food for the days you are attending
Ice for coolers can purchased on site
Earplugs
Umbrella or parasol
Gathering
Checklist:
camping equipment and useful gadgets
The short list for camping essentials to make your Bliss Burn comfortable and radically prepared.
Tent and a shade structure if necessary
Sleeping bag or bed linen
Blanket/towel for river
Headlamp/flashlight & batteries/charger
Camping/yoga mat and or an air mattress
Pillows
Camping chairs and a foldable table if necessary
Tape
Pocket knife
Camping mallet for putting up a tent
Bin bags PACK IT IN PACK IT OUT.
(Solar) lights for your camp and tent
Rope

Gathering
Checklist:
food and drinks
Meals plans can be purchased here.
ONE meal plan includes THREE meals. Locally sourced veggie dishes with option of meat will be served. If you are a local and desire to enhance the experience bringing food to share is a great way to co-create. Hot water station(s) will be available.
Please bring your own bowls/cups/cutlery.
Please remember NO GLASS.
